#2 Actually not... at least for now. As I have posted a few days ago Russia will benefit from Kyoto, at least for the next years since they don't meet the quota of Kyoto yet (those were calculated on the higher Soviet level of 1992 or so). Russia will make heavy profits on selling quotas. Could be more than 20bn dollars.
If Russia reaches the quota limits in 5 years or later... we'll talk again.
First the billions... and WTO
Putin's no fool
